Im currently finishing up my 5color God EDH deck with Karona, The False God as my commander. Im definitely not an old MTG player so a lot of the old EDH staples are hard for me to know. Any help on good cards for a 5 color deck or EDH in general i would appreciate. Thanks

I have a List of EDH Staples and Power Cards that might be of use.
You'll find mana rocks like Coalition Relic and Chromatic Lantern to be useful. Farseek is also good if you're running shocks.
For lands, look into Command Tower , Reflecting Pool , and some of the other multilands.

City of Brass and the new version Mana Confluence would both be good ideas. fetch lands as wellif you can afford them. other mana dorks would be good as well, such as Sylvan Caryatid and Birds of Paradise . you may want to consider some wrath effects as well. Supreme Verdict , Wrath of God , Austere Command . etc. lastly, tutor effects Demonic Tutor , Enlightened Tutor , and you get the idea. don't forget to add some draw power to the deck as well. draw is very important in every format.

I'd consider the Bringers from the original Mirrodin set as staples in a five color deck. The Bringer of the Red Dawn , Bringer of the Blue Dawn , and Bringer of the Black Dawn in particular. They aren't expensive cards either.

First up. Never use Krona as a commander unless you have NO other options. She is the worst 5 color Legendary creature. Child of Alara would wreck in a God deck, as you can kill the kid and no gods would die from its ability, as all are indestructible. A great creature for any 5 color deck is Maelstrom Archangel as she can whip out a god multiple times. If you are running five colors, i would go with Birds of Paradise , Utopia Tree , Chromatic Lantern , Sylvan Caryatid , and Somberwald Sage , as all can generate a great variety of mana. A good way to make maximum use of each god is to play to each's individual strengths, while still getting the needed devotion.
